Advice requested: Outdoor table build
Hello WWFers!
I am in the process of building an outdoor dining table from Sugar Gum. Dimensions will be approx 2350 x 1050, and I'm using 2350 x 190 x 43mm slats of Sugar Gum.
The weight of the timber is approx 110 -140kg by my estimate.
The plan is to use some prefab steel legs (SS210W2 Trapezoid Dining Table legs, Wide Top, 1 Pair 71 X 71cm - Taylor's Collection), however I haven't yet decided how to pin the slats together.
My first thought is to use 4 flat steel bars, something like a 75mm x 6mm flat bar, recessed into the underside, however I don't know if it will hold the slats together while its being moved around. Using mild steel would make it easier to drill slots for the fixings wide enough to accomodate some movement of the timber.
Is this likely to work just fine? Am I overthinking this? Am I missing something?

Hi timelord9,
When you say slats, will they have a gap between them or be hard up against each other like floorboards? Being an outside table, the wood will swell and shrink with the seasons and humidity.
